Tianjin destroyed imported fruits from Spain

On March 15, personnel from Tianjinn Inspection and Quarantine Bureau destroyed a batch of imported fruits from Spain. This batch of fruits includes more than 2,000 boxes of fresh lemon and oranges, a total of over 20 tons, worth 14,000 Euro. 
 
It is known that this is the first entry of imported fruits from Spain to Tianjin. Last year, Tianjinn Inspection and Quarantine Bureau imported a total of 2,647 batches of fruits, which was a total weight of 139,000 tons, or a total value of $ 140 million. 
 
Among these imported fruits a total of 61 batches are detected as not qualified and thus destroyed.
